Regular Military Compensation (RMC) is defined as the sum of basic pay, average basic allowance for housing, basic allowance for subsistence, and the federal income tax advantage that accrues because the allowances are not subject to federal income tax. RMC Calculator - RMC represents a basic level of compensation which every service member receives, directly or indirectly, in-cash or in-kind, and which is common to all military personnel. In a combat zone as designated by the president in an executive order, A qualified hazardous duty area designated by Congress while receiving hostile fire pay or imminent danger pay in accordance with 37 USC 310, An area outside the combat zone or qualified hazardous duty area when the U.S. Department of Defense certifies that such service is in direct support of military operations in a combat zone or qualified hazardous duty area, and you receive hostile fire pay or imminent danger pay, Active-duty pay earned in any month you serve in a combat zone, Re-enlistment bonus pay if the voluntary extension or re-enlistment occurs in a month served in a combat zone (future bonus installments will also be tax free if the extensions were signed in the combat zone), Pay for accumulated leave days earned in any month served in a combat zone, Pay received for duties as a member of the armed forces in any nonappropriated fund activities, Awards for suggestions, inventions or scientific achievements you are entitled to because of a submission you made in a month you served in a combat zone, Student loan repayments made during deployment to a combat zone. Commissioned officers may only exclude the highest rate of enlisted pay plus any imminent danger or hostile fire pay received while in a combat zone. Any tax liability from a member of the armed forces will be forgiven or refunded if that service member dies while in a combat zone. Any member of the armed forces who becomes a prisoner of war or is missing in action as a direct result of serving in a combat zone will continue to earn tax-excluded income for the duration of their status as a POW or MIA member of the armed forces.
